Chosen by Air China for a B747 integration program, Heath Tecna provided engineering, supplied kit parts, and obtained an STC to reconfigure nine aircraft with two different LOPAs. Reconfiguration work was driven primarily by the installation of new first class and business class seats, as well as an IFE system upgrade. Economy class seating was modified, PC/seat power systems were overhauled, and new BFE video control closets were also installed. In addition, updated ACCESS layouts and programming were provided along with on-site staff to support the database upgrade.
CAP kits to upgrade Zone B were ordered, which meant the removal of centerline bins on four of the aircraft, to be replaced with new sculpted ceiling panels. An ECLS lighting upgrade was also installed in several zones on all aircraft and the EEPL was reworked. Other work included the supply or modification of PSUs, doorway liners, overhead bin parts, VCC ventilation systems, floor systems, wiring/cables, and new structural supports.
First class and business class cabin furnishings were also manufactured by Heath Tecna for the program which included centerline bar units, centerline serving units, outboard integrated seat stowages, partitions, curtain assemblies, and monument fairings. Each bar unit featured a granite counter, custom bent liquor retaining racks, curvilinear panels, an ice bucket, stowage for amenities, and scenic artwork.
